The Vought Corsair was one of the most unusual but also most successful Navy aircraft of World War II. Feared by the Japanese enemy, who gave it the nickname Whispering Death, it fought its way through the Pacific skies from 1943 to 1945 and achieved record-breaking successes: 2140 enemy aircraft were destroyed and 189 of its own were lost. The Corsairs concentrated firepower consisted of six 12.7 mm Browning machine guns.
Its characteristic bent wings made it highly recognizable to the ground troops, who called it the Sweetheart of Okinawa. The F4U-1A was the first batch with major changes, with a top speed of 671 km/h.
